|
@@ -9,7 +9,14 @@
|
|
|
width="900px"
|
|
|
class="statistic-dialog-cont"
|
|
|
>
|
|
|
- <div v-if="hasQustion">
|
|
|
+ <div>
|
|
|
+ <!-- 区域筛选 -->
|
|
|
+ <el-select v-model="regionValue" v-if="region!=='oversea'" @change="getStatisticDetail">
|
|
|
+ <el-option :value="-1" label="全部区域"></el-option>
|
|
|
+ <el-option :value="0" label="国内"></el-option>
|
|
|
+ <el-option :value="1" label="海外"></el-option>
|
|
|
+ </el-select>
|
|
|
+ <template v-if="hasQustion">
|
|
|
<el-select v-model="statusType" @change="getStatisticDetail">
|
|
|
<el-option label="全部" :value="0"></el-option>
|
|
|
<el-option label="已完成" :value="1"></el-option>
|
|
@@ -24,6 +31,7 @@
|
|
|
</div>
|
|
|
<i class="el-icon-info"></i>
|
|
|
</el-tooltip>
|
|
|
+ </template>
|
|
|
</div>
|
|
|
<el-table
|
|
|
:data="tableData"
|
|
@@ -135,6 +143,7 @@ export default {
|
|
|
statusType:1,
|
|
|
isShowViewAnswer:false,
|
|
|
currentAddAnswerData:{},
|
|
|
+ regionValue:-1,
|
|
|
}
|
|
|
},
|
|
|
methods: {
|
|
@@ -183,7 +192,8 @@ export default {
|
|
|
EndDate: endDate,
|
|
|
AdminId: userid,
|
|
|
AdminType: this.fromType,
|
|
|
- Status:this.hasQustion?this.statusType:0
|
|
|
+ Status:this.hasQustion?this.statusType:0,
|
|
|
+ EnglishCompany:this.regionValue,
|
|
|
}).then(res => {
|
|
|
const { Ret,Data } = res;
|
|
|
|
|
@@ -199,6 +209,7 @@ export default {
|
|
|
/* 取消 */
|
|
|
cancel() {
|
|
|
this.statusType=this.hasQustion?1:0
|
|
|
+ this.regionValue=-1
|
|
|
this.$emit('update:isShow', false);
|
|
|
},
|
|
|
|